Onboarding: LiftPath Simulator

Release manager notes. Builds run nightly from the main branch; simulation seeds are pinned per release. Don't cut a release if the dispatch regression suite is red. Artifacts publish to the Harrow depot automatically. The signing vault requires manual unlock after each depot rotation. Use the recovery passphrase below to unlock it.

vault phrase of bagaf-kajeg = jorath-feniel-briir-siliel-ralix

## Shrinkwright CLI 4.0 — Changed Defaults

Heads up, support team: Shrinkwright 4.0 changes several resize defaults. Output format now defaults to WebP instead of JPEG, default quality drops from 92 to 85, and parallel workers default to the host core count rather than 4. Customers reporting unexpected output sizes are almost certainly on 4.0 with inherited configs. The new default configuration shipped with 4.0 is as follows.

service settings:
[casax]
port = 6379
team = rusir
host = casax.zemvarhq.corp
region = outer-4
access_code = ac_9808ce
timeout_ms = 1500

BRIEFING — LEADERSHIP REVIEW

Subject: Support outsourcing, Project Cairnwell.

Decision pending on moving tier-one support to Veldora Services. Cost per ticket falls 31%. Sales leads should note contract renewals may see short-term friction during transition. Handover window: eight weeks. Risk register attached separately. The detail below is confidential and must not leave this review.

board note of baweg-bawig: Project Tamath slips by six weeks because of the audit delay.